    Nashville Ballet 2's new ballet designed especially for grades 5-8, exposes the audience to the art of dance in an abstract form. Audiences learn to look at a non-story ballet for the quality of its movement, the feelings that are conveyed, and the use of music as it relates to the theme of the piece. Using the original Bebop score by James Spinazzola, Director of Instrumental Studies at the University of Indianapolis, choreographer Kathleen Spinnazzola will look at the theme of the hero next door in an fast-paced urban environment. Inspired by recent global tragedies, she will show the humanity in all of us in the face of great catastrophe. Running time: 1 hour
